Archaeology Day at Museum

On September 7, enjoy Archaeology Day at Museum! From 10:00 am to noon, “Archaeology in Dubois County” a panel discussion with archaeologist, Dr. Rick Jones, and local collectors, Kenny Hochgesang and Derrick Haas takes place. At 10:30 am to 11 am, a discussion on stone tools and weapons by Derrick Haas is scheduled. From 11 am – noon, artifact identification by Dr. Rck Jones, retired state archaeologist.

All Day

Visit the museum’s display “People of the Woodlands: Native Americans of Dubois County” during open hours from 10 am to 4 pm.
